{"id":17031,"date":"2024-08-22T14:06:15","date_gmt":"2024-08-22T14:06:15","guid":{"rendered":"https:\/\/averybit.com\/?p=17031"},"modified":"2024-08-30T09:23:03","modified_gmt":"2024-08-30T09:23:03","slug":"xamarin-mobile-app-development-the-ultimate-complete-guide","status":"publish","type":"post","link":"https:\/\/averybit.com\/de\/xamarin-mobile-app-development-the-ultimate-complete-guide\/","title":{"rendered":"Xamarin Mobile App Development: The Ultimate Complete Guide"},"content":{"rendered":"<div data-elementor-type=\"wp-post\" data-elementor-id=\"17031\" class=\"elementor elementor-17031\" data-elementor-post-type=\"post\">\n\t\t\t\t\t\t<section class=\"elementor-section elementor-top-section elementor-element elementor-element-13235fc elementor-section-boxed elementor-section-height-default elementor-section-height-default\" data-id=\"13235fc\" data-element_type=\"section\">\n\t\t\t\t\t\t<div class=\"elementor-container elementor-column-gap-default\">\n\t\t\t\t\t<div class=\"elementor-column elementor-col-100 elementor-top-column elementor-element elementor-element-4080b95\" data-id=\"4080b95\" data-element_type=\"column\">\n\t\t\t<div class=\"elementor-widget-wrap elementor-element-populated\">\n\t\t\t\t\t\t<div class=\"elementor-element elementor-element-3f5c7b3 elementor-widget elementor-widget-text-editor\" data-id=\"3f5c7b3\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t\t<p><span style=\"font-weight: 400\">Are you all set to push forward the development of your mobile applications? You only need to look at Xamarin, the innovative framework that is revolutionizing the process of creating apps. We go into great detail on why Xamarin is the best option available to developers today in our comprehensive guide to<\/span><a href=\"https:\/\/averybit.com\/de\/how-much-does-it-cost-to-build-app-a-complete-guide-2024\/\" target=\"_blank\" rel=\"noopener\"><span style=\"font-weight: 400\"> developing mobile apps<\/span><\/a><span style=\"font-weight: 400\"> with Xamarin.\u00a0<\/span><\/p><p><span style=\"font-weight: 400\">With Xamarin&#8217;s extensive feature set and outstanding flexibility, you can easily develop high-performing, cross-platform applications. Our in-depth guide will provide you with the knowledge you must know about Xamarin and improve your app development approach, regardless of your goals\u2014streamlining your development process or offering a better user experience.<\/span><\/p>\t\t\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-f7d1777 elementor-widget elementor-widget-spacer\" data-id=\"f7d1777\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-2fafab5 elementor-widget elementor-widget-heading\" data-id=\"2fafab5\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<h2 class=\"elementor-heading-title elementor-size-default\">Overview of Xamarin<\/h2>\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-7c2b682 elementor-widget elementor-widget-spacer\" data-id=\"7c2b682\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-a4d47cf elementor-widget elementor-widget-text-editor\" data-id=\"a4d47cf\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t\t<p><span style=\"font-weight: 400\">As a leading framework for <\/span><a href=\"https:\/\/averybit.com\/de\/a-comprehensive-guide-to-cross-platform-app-development\/\" target=\"_blank\" rel=\"noopener\"><span style=\"font-weight: 400\">cross-platform mobile app development<\/span><\/a><span style=\"font-weight: 400\"> in 2024, Xamarin gives professionals a consistent way to create Windows, iOS, and Android apps using a single codebase. With sophisticated Just-In-Time (JIT) and Ahead-of-Time (AOT) compilation processes, Xamarin makes use of the potential of.NET 7 to deliver increased performance, guaranteeing faster and more efficient app execution.\u00a0<\/span><\/p><p><span style=\"font-weight: 400\">The evolution of the framework to become.NET MAUI (Multi-platform App UI) has simplified the process of developing user interfaces (UIs) and made it possible to create designs that are natively performant and consistent across platforms. Xamarin&#8217;s extensive connection with Microsoft Azure extends its usefulness by giving developers access to a range of powerful cloud services.\u00a0<\/span><\/p>\t\t\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-60be01e elementor-widget elementor-widget-spacer\" data-id=\"60be01e\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-8344ec5 elementor-widget elementor-widget-heading\" data-id=\"8344ec5\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<h3 class=\"elementor-heading-title elementor-size-default\">Why Xamarin is the Ideal Choice for 2024?<\/h3>\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-6a92f81 elementor-widget elementor-widget-spacer\" data-id=\"6a92f81\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-37559bc elementor-widget elementor-widget-text-editor\" data-id=\"37559bc\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t\t<p><span style=\"font-weight: 400\">Being ahead of the curve is crucial for organizations to maintain their competitiveness in the quickly changing tech world. In addition, Xamarin has become the clear leader in the field of cross-platform app development. Xamarin has emerged as the top option for 2024 and beyond because of its capacity to develop robust and flexible applications for a variety of platforms.\u00a0<\/span><\/p><p><span style=\"font-weight: 400\">Investing in separate development teams for iOS and Android is no longer necessary for enterprises. The strong infrastructure of Xamarin enables developers to save time and resources by writing code only once and deploying it across several platforms. It also guarantees uniformity as well as consistency in the user experience across various devices, which speeds up the development process.\u00a0<\/span><\/p><p><span style=\"font-weight: 400\">Moreover, Xamarin&#8217;s extensive tool and resource ecosystem, together with its integration with Microsoft, adds even more fascination. With Xamarin, developers can fully utilize Microsoft&#8217;s suite of products, from Visual Studio to Azure, as it syncs with them smoothly.\u00a0<\/span><\/p><p><span style=\"font-weight: 400\">For companies hoping to stay ahead of the curve as technology continues to define our future, Xamarin is the obvious choice. It will be a powerful force in the coming years due to its cross-platform features and solid Microsoft integration.<\/span><\/p>\t\t\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-3f19ca0 elementor-widget elementor-widget-spacer\" data-id=\"3f19ca0\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-3306b75 elementor-widget elementor-widget-heading\" data-id=\"3306b75\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<h3 class=\"elementor-heading-title elementor-size-default\">Key Features of Xamarin App Development<\/h3>\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-78a783e elementor-widget elementor-widget-spacer\" data-id=\"78a783e\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-654f1d7 elementor-widget elementor-widget-text-editor\" data-id=\"654f1d7\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t\t<ul><li style=\"font-weight: 400\"><span style=\"font-weight: 400\">For almost all of the core platform SDKs in both iOS and Android, Xamarin has bindings. These bindings also offer comprehensive type checking during development and compile time, and they are strongly typed, making them simple to use and browse. As a result, runtime errors are reduced and applications are of greater quality.<\/span><\/li><li style=\"font-weight: 400\"><span style=\"font-weight: 400\">C#, an emerging language with several features over Objective-C and Java, is used to write Xamarin apps. These characteristics include dynamic language capabilities, functional constructs like lambdas and LINQ, parallel programming tools, advanced generics, etc.<\/span><\/li><li style=\"font-weight: 400\"><span style=\"font-weight: 400\">Xamarin utilizes Visual Studio for Windows and Xamarin Studio for Mac OS X. The complex Project and Solution management system, the extensive project template library, integrated source control, code auto-completion, and many other features are all included in these two contemporary IDEs.<\/span><\/li><li style=\"font-weight: 400\"><span style=\"font-weight: 400\">With the help of Xamarin, you may use a vast range of pre-written third-party code by directly invoking Objective-C, Java, C, and C++ libraries. This allows you to utilize Objective-C, Java, or C\/C++ libraries that are already available for iOS and Android. You may also bind native Objective-C and Java libraries with ease using a declarative syntax with the binding projects that Xamarin provides.<\/span><\/li><\/ul>\t\t\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-6e56797 elementor-widget elementor-widget-spacer\" data-id=\"6e56797\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-ffc0ef7 elementor-widget elementor-widget-heading\" data-id=\"ffc0ef7\" data-element_type=\"widget\" data-widget_type=\"heading.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t<h4 class=\"elementor-heading-title elementor-size-default\">How AveryBit Can Help with Xamarin Development?<\/h4>\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-2b8e02c elementor-widget elementor-widget-spacer\" data-id=\"2b8e02c\" data-element_type=\"widget\" data-widget_type=\"spacer.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t<div class=\"elementor-spacer\">\n\t\t\t<div class=\"elementor-spacer-inner\"><\/div>\n\t\t<\/div>\n\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t<div class=\"elementor-element elementor-element-9dfafca elementor-widget elementor-widget-text-editor\" data-id=\"9dfafca\" data-element_type=\"widget\" data-widget_type=\"text-editor.default\">\n\t\t\t\t<div class=\"elementor-widget-container\">\n\t\t\t\t\t\t\t\t\t<p><span style=\"font-weight: 400\">At AveryBit, our expertise lies in turning your mobile app ideas into reality with our proficient Xamarin development services. Our talented team creates high-performing, cross-platform apps that stand out in the cutthroat market of today by utilizing the newest Xamarin technology. You can get comprehensive functionality, adaptable UI designs, and easy connection with iOS, Android, and Windows by selecting AveryBit \u2014 all from one code base. We customize our strategy to meet your unique requirements, guaranteeing prompt delivery, economical operation, and an enhanced user experience.\u00a0<\/span><span style=\"font-weight: 400\">Allow us to use Xamarin&#8217;s cutting-edge features to elevate your mobile app to new heights. To begin developing your next ground-breaking app, get in touch with us right now!<\/span><\/p><p>\u00a0<\/p>\t\t\t\t\t\t\t\t<\/div>\n\t\t\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t<\/div>\n\t\t\t\t\t<\/div>\n\t\t<\/section>\n\t\t\t\t<\/div>","protected":false},"excerpt":{"rendered":"<p>Are you all set to push forward the development of your mobile applications? You only need to look at Xamarin, the innovative framework that is revolutionizing the process of creating apps. We go into great detail on why Xamarin is the best option available to developers today in our comprehensive guide to developing mobile apps&hellip;<\/p>","protected":false},"author":1,"featured_media":17032,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"content-type":"","footnotes":""},"categories":[95],"tags":[185,178],"class_list":["post-17031","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-productivity","tag-mobile-app-development","tag-xamarin"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/posts\/17031","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/comments?post=17031"}],"version-history":[{"count":28,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/posts\/17031\/revisions"}],"predecessor-version":[{"id":17073,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/posts\/17031\/revisions\/17073"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/media\/17032"}],"wp:attachment":[{"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/media?parent=17031"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/categories?post=17031"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/averybit.com\/de\/wp-json\/wp\/v2\/tags?post=17031"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}